Msembe Beef Stew

A hearty and flavorful Zambian beef stew featuring tender chunks of beef simmered with vegetables in a rich, savory broth, often seasoned with local spices.

Temps de préparation25 minutes
Temps de cuisson2 hours 30 minutes
Temps total2 hours 55 minutes
Portions6
DifficultéMedium

🧂 Ingrédients

  • 1 kg Beef(stewing cuts like chuck or brisket, cubed)
  • 2 tbsp Vegetable oil
  • 2 large Onions(chopped)
  • 4 cloves Garlic(minced)
  • 400 g Tomatoes(chopped, fresh or canned)
  • 2 medium Carrots(peeled and chopped)
  • 2 medium Potatoes(peeled and cubed)
  • 750 ml Beef broth or water
  • 2 tbsp Tomato paste
  • 2 Bay leaves
  • 1 tsp Thyme(dried)
  • 1 tsp Salt(or to taste)
  • 0.5 tsp Black pepper(freshly ground, or to taste)
  • 1 tsp Curry powder(optional, for added flavor)

💡 Conseils de pro

  • Browning the beef well is crucial for developing deep flavor.
  • Low and slow simmering is key to tender beef.
  • If the stew is too thin, you can mash some of the potatoes against the side of the pot to thicken it, or simmer uncovered for the last 15-20 minutes.
  • For a richer flavor, you can add a splash of red wine when adding the broth.

Idées de variations

Inspiration pour votre propre version de cette recette

  • Add other vegetables like peas, green beans, or bell peppers during the last 30 minutes of cooking.
  • For a spicier stew, add a chopped chili pepper along with the onions and garlic.
  • A small amount of ground mungongo nuts can be added for a traditional Zambian touch.
